While this unconventional remedy may sound (and look) odd, mouth taping brands claim that it helps stop snoring by promoting nasal breathing during sleep.
“Breathing in and out of the mouth can cause your airways to become dry and irritated, leading to hypersensitive airways, a dry mouth, sore throat and irritating cough,” explains Patel.
